                             USAA INVESTMENT TRUST
                              INCOME STRATEGY FUND


                       SUPPLEMENT DATED DECEMBER 15, 2000
                            TO THE FUND'S PROSPECTUS
                             DATED OCTOBER 1, 2000

Page 12 of the Income Strategy Fund's  prospectus under the heading  "Portfolio
Managers" is amended to reflect the  following  change  effective  December 15,
2000.

Portfolio  Managers

WILLIAM VAN ARNUM,  associate portfolio manager of Equity Investments,  assumes
portfolio management  responsibilities of the Stocks investment category of the
Income Strategy Fund replacing David G. Parsons.

Mr.  Van Arnum has 14 years'  investment  management  experience  and  became a
member of our portfolio  management team in June 2000.  Prior to joining us, he
worked for the University of California,  Office of the Treasurer,  from August
1992 to May 2000. He earned the Chartered Financial Analyst designation in 1989
and is a member of the Association  for Investment  Management and Research and
the San Francisco  Financial  Analysts  Society,  Inc. He holds an MBA from San
Francisco  State  University  and  a  BS  from  California   Polytechnic  State
University, San Luis Obispo.

                             USAA INVESTMENT TRUST
                             BALANCED STRATEGY FUND


                       SUPPLEMENT DATED DECEMBER 15, 2000
                            TO THE FUND'S PROSPECTUS
                             DATED OCTOBER 1, 2000

Page 12 of the Balanced Strategy Fund's prospectus under the heading "Portfolio
Managers" is amended to reflect the  following  change  effective  December 15,
2000.

Portfolio Managers

TIMOTHY P. BEYER,  associate portfolio manager of Equity  Investments,  assumes
portfolio management  responsibilities of the Stocks investment category of the
Balanced  Strategy Fund replacing David G. Parsons.  Mr. Beyer will also act as
the asset allocation manager of the Fund.

Mr. Beyer has ten years' investment  management  experience and became a member
of our portfolio management team in August 2000. Prior to joining us, he worked
for Banc of America Capital  Management Inc. from December 1988 to August 2000.
He earned the Chartered  Financial Analyst  designation in 1993 and is a member
of the  Association  for  Investment  Management  and  Research  and the  North
Carolina  Society of  Financial  Analysts.  He holds a BSBA from East  Carolina
University.
